This trek is
one of the most popular long walks in
the Cordillera Blanca which begins in
the town of Cashapampa (2900 m.). We’ll
pass the valley of Santa Cruz and we’ll
observe the peaks of those ravines (Santa
Cruz, Aguja, Caraz, Quitaraju, Alpamayo,
and Arteson Raju) and at the bottom we’ll
see the Taulliraju next to the Paso Punta
Unión (4750 m.) where both valleys
can be seen as well as the Lakes of Ichic
Cocha, Jatun Cocha, and Taullicocha. Later,
we’ll observe the highest snow-capped
mountains of the Cordillera Blanca (Huascarán,
Huandoy, Chacraraju, Chopicalqui, and
Pisco) and the Lakes of Llanganuco surrounded
by quenuales and other bushes.
|
• Altitude:
2900 – 4750 m.
• Degree of difficulty:
Moderate
• Months of trek: (May
- October) |

| THE
EXPEDITION LASTS: 1 to 5 days/ 1
to 7 days |
 |
| |
Day 1: Aclimatación
Day 2: Cashapampa – llamacorral
Day 3: Llamacorral – taullipampa
Day 4: Taullipampa – cachinapampa
Day 5: Cachinapampa – vaquería
– Pampamachay
Day 6: Pampamachay - Cebollapampa
Day 7: Cebollapampa – Huaraz
